Market news: The United States plans to impose sanctions on Venezuela due to election disputes.
2024-09-03 00:11
Odaily News The United States is developing new sanctions against Venezuelan government officials in response to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ro's controversial re-election in July. The U.S. Treasury Department is about to announce 15 individual sanctions against Maduro's subordinates, saying that these officials "impeded the holding of free and fair presidential elections." The United States said the measures target key leaders who worked with Maduro to undermine the July 28 vote, including electoral authorities, Venezuela's Supreme Court, the National Assembly, and members of the National Intelligence Agency and the General Directorate of Military Counterintelligence. The plan will be announced as early as this week and may change before it is finalized. (Jin Shi)
